The dust is beginning to settle following Swansea City's 3-0 defeat to Blackburn on Saturday.It was a tough afternoon for home supporters, who were full of enthusiasm for the season ahead.

Expectations may have to be tempered; Swansea have brought in four players so far this summer in Joe Allen, Matty Sorinola, Harry Darling and Nathan Wood, but the performance and result against Rovers shows more work is clearly needed.Swansea face Oxford United in the Carabao Cup on Tuesday night and head coach Russell Martin is expected to ring the changes to his starting XI.
